Kronecker Products Which Decompose into Two Irreducible Representations

摘要

The aim of the work is to determine, for the semisimple Lie algebra of types Bsub(n), Csub(n) and Dsub(n) sets of pairs of irreducible representations having the property that the Kronecker product of the representations of each pair decomposes into a direct sum of two irreducible representations. The proof uses Dynkin theorem and a calculation of dimensionalities. The pairs of representations obtained in this way are ((m lambda /sub 1/), ( lambda sub(n)) for algebras of type Bsub(n), (( lambda /sub 1/), (m lambda sub(n)) for algebras of type Csub(n), and ((m lambda /sub 1/), ( lambda sub(n-1)), ((m lambda /sub 1/), ( lambda sub(n)), (( lambda /sub 1/), (m lambda sub(n-1)), (( lambda /sub 1/), (m lambda sub(n)) for algebras of type Dsub(n)3/where lambda sub(i) denotes the highest weight of the fundamental representation ( lambda sub(i)) and m is an arbitrary positive integer. 9 refs.
